Exploring the Landscape: Prescription vs. Over-the-Counter Medications

When facing health concerns, deciding between prescription and over-the-counter (OTC) drugs can be difficult. Prescription preparations require a doctor's prescription, reflecting their potential for moderate side effects or interactions. OTC remedies are readily available without a prescription, offering relief for everyday ailments. At its core, the choice depends on the severity of your condition. Consulting with a healthcare professional is always advised to ensure you select the most appropriate course of action for your specific needs.

Common Solutions for Problems

Over-the-counter treatments are widely obtainable for a variety of frequent problems. From headaches and aches to colds and irritations, these non-prescription choices can provide much-needed comfort. Pharmacies are stocked with a wide range of products to address these frequent health concerns.

It's important to always examine the instructions carefully before using any over-the-counter product. Talk to a healthcare professional if you have any doubts or if your symptoms are severe.
